About the course

5-day (30 hours) LIVE virtual classroom course

IATA Competency-Based Training for Dangerous Goods Instructor aviation training course

This course is recommended for Instructors of Dangerous Goods training as per IATA's DGR - section 1.5 Find out more about the CBTA approach, current courses and previous corresponding categories.

Under a Competency-Based Training and Assessment (CBTA) approach, the instructor plays a critical role in facilitating the trainees’ progression toward their achievement of relevant competencies. The instructor is also required to be actively involved in evaluating the effectiveness of the training program to support continuous improvement. In this course, you will acquire techniques and strategies to plan robust CBTA-compliant dangerous goods training programs. You will learn how to develop training sessions, impart knowledge through active learning, sequence learning activities to ensure an effective mix and flow, and conclude training sessions with an emphasis on a competency-focused approach. You will have ample opportunities to learn and practice a variety of core techniques to lead adult learning, communication and presentation skills, and effective facilitation techniques. Furthermore, you will obtain practical, workable solutions for successful classroom management and media usage.

What you will learn

Upon completing this course you will be able to:

  • Apply a regulatory framework using a CBTA approach
  • Recognize CBTA concepts and their benefits to all stakeholders
  • Recognize the “analyze, design and develop” process and apply it to dangerous goods training
  • Implement a competency-based training and assessment strategy and plan
  • Acquire techniques and strategies to plan and deliver robust CBTA compliant dangerous goods training programs
  • Contribute to the overall effectiveness and quality of the training program

Course content

The key topics that are covered during this course include:

  • Interpreting CBTA concepts, principles, benefits
  • Understanding competency factors
  • Recognizing stakeholders and their roles and responsibilities in CBTA
  • Using a CBTA approach to develop, implement, and execute effective instructional and assessment plans
  • Understanding and applying adult learning principles
  • Learning practical facilitation techniques
  • Applying facilitation techniques for effective classroom management in face-to-face or virtual environments
  • Designing engaging visual or electronic aids required for the training unit
  • Mastering communication and presentation skills
  • Analyzing and evaluating feedback to ensure continuous improvement

Who should attend

This course is recommended for:

  • Dangerous Goods instructors, trainers and assessors
  • Supervisors and line managers involved in training and assessment
  • Companies aiming to obtain IATA CBTA Center certification

Certificate awarded

An IATA Certificate of Completion is awarded to participants obtaining a grade of 80% or higher on an assessment. A special distinction is awarded to participants obtaining a grade of 90% or higher.
